Letter from the Director

New information regarding Henderson office closure

CARSON CITY – Here at the Nevada DMV, we’ve recently heard lots of feedback about our decision to relocate our Henderson location to the intersection of Silverado Ranch and Valley View west of I-15 in south Las Vegas.

As Director of the DMV, I want to assure you that the new Silverado Ranch facility will still be equipped to handle all the needs of Henderson residents, especially with this location’s new easy and intuitive layout for customers. While we believe the Silverado Ranch facility – along with the services we’re preparing to move online – will be able to comfortably serve our customers in the South Valley, we understand that moving services farther from you can be an inconvenience.

Driver’s licenses and identification services are one of our shared concerns, as these services often require more frequent repeat visits to our office for older members of our communities. As such, we’re searching for a solution to allow for access to select DMV services with a focus on DL/ID needs.

One of the solutions we’re evaluating is expanding our existing partnerships within the automotive industry. Our partners at AAA already provide access to most vehicle registration services, movement permits, basic license plate services, issuance of handicapped plates and placards, and they can process duplicate title orders – and they do it all at no additional charge, even for non-members. Depending on the engagement with the community and the agreements reached with local officials, the DMV may be able to have pop-up DMV services at public locations at least once a week.

Additionally, we’re also looking to maintain a smaller satellite office in the existing location with the intention of training the public how to use our online tools and processing driver license or identification transactions.

In an ideal world, we would be able to keep both facilities open, but regrettably, the DMV is only allotted a certain percentage of the Nevada State Highway Fund to operate with – and the State Highway Fund doesn’t stretch as far as it used to. However, the DMV is more ready than ever to assist customers in an effective, efficient, and caring way.

Please rest assured that we are committed to finding an amenable solution for both our agency and your community, and we’re looking forward to our partnership going forward.
